Tarleton State takes on UT Arlington, seeks to end 5-game skid

Tarleton State Texans (12-16, 6-11 WAC) at UT Arlington Mavericks (10-18, 4-12 WAC)

Arlington, Texas; Thursday, 7:30 p.m. EST

BOTTOM LINE: Tarleton State comes into the matchup against UT Arlington as losers of five in a row.

The Mavericks are 7-4 in home games. UT Arlington ranks fifth in the WAC at limiting opponent scoring, allowing 67.2 points while holding opponents to 39.3% shooting.

The Texans are 6-11 against WAC opponents. Tarleton State is 5-12 against opponents over .500.

UT Arlington’s average of 3.8 made 3-pointers per game is 3.0 fewer made shots on average than the 6.8 per game Tarleton State gives up. Tarleton State averages 65.1 points per game, 2.1 fewer than the 67.2 UT Arlington allows.

The teams play for the third time in conference play this season. Tarleton State won the last meeting 51-37 on Jan. 22. Gia Adams scored 12 points to help lead the Texans to the victory.

TOP PERFORMERS: Kira Reynolds is averaging 12.9 points, eight rebounds and 2.4 blocks for the Mavericks. Jadyn Atchison is averaging 9.6 points over the last 10 games.

Adams is averaging 11.4 points and 3.8 assists for the Texans. Jakoriah Long is averaging 15.4 points over the last 10 games.

LAST 10 GAMES: Mavericks: 2-8, averaging 62.4 points, 33.2 rebounds, 11.5 assists, 9.0 steals and 4.2 blocks per game while shooting 37.5%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 71.4 points per game.

Texans: 2-8, averaging 63.0 points, 35.2 rebounds, 11.3 assists, 7.7 steals and 3.8 blocks per game while shooting 38.5%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 68.2 points.

Hawkeyes are set to play Vanderbilt in a November women’s basketball game in Sioux City, Iowa

SIOUX CITY, Iowa (AP) — Vanderbilt and Iowa, both ranked in the top 10 late last season, will meet in a women's basketball game early next season in northwest Iowa, the schools announced Tuesday. The neutral-site game is set for Nov. 15 at the Tyson Events Center, which is 290 miles from Carver-Hawkeye Arena in Iowa City. Vanderbilt is 4-0 all-time against the Hawkeyes. This will be the teams' first meeting since 1997. The Commodores are expected to return national scoring leader Mikayla Blakes. She averaged 27 points per game and was Southeastern Conference player of the year. Vanderbilt was ranked as high as No. 5 and finished No. 10 with a 29-5 record after reaching the NCAA Sweet 16.
